Dogecoin DOGE deposits working at 4 bitcoin casinos but withdrawal options limited to BTC only

Been testing Dogecoin deposits across different bitcoin casinos this week. Wild Casino, Super Slots, Cafe Casino, and BetWhale all accept DOGE deposits with 6 confirmations taking about 6-12 minutes.

The weird part? All four force you to withdraw in Bitcoin only. No DOGE withdrawal option despite accepting deposits. Deposit 500 DOGE, win 800 DOGE equivalent, but cashout gets converted to BTC at their exchange rate.

Wild Casino shows 0.99 DOGE = $1 on deposits but 1.02 DOGE = $1 on the forced BTC conversion. That 3% spread adds up fast on bigger wins.

Anyone else notice this DOGE deposit/BTC withdrawal setup? Seems like they want the cheap DOGE network fees for deposits but avoid DOGE volatility on payouts.

    Same experience at Cafe Casino last month. Deposited 1,200 DOGE, hit a decent slots run, but the BTC conversion killed my profit margin. They quoted 0.98 DOGE per dollar on deposit, then 1.05 DOGE per dollar when forcing the BTC withdrawal.

    Sticking to straight BTC deposits now. Yeah, the network fees are higher, but at least there's no conversion spread eating into wins. DOGE deposits are tempting with those 1-minute confirmations, but the withdrawal setup is a trap.

    BetWhale actually lets you withdraw DOGE if you contact support first. Had to send them two emails, but they manually enabled DOGE withdrawals for my account after proving I deposited with it.

    Took 3 days to get approved, then DOGE withdrawals processed in 45 minutes. Still charged a 50 DOGE fee when network cost is like 2 DOGE, but better than the BTC conversion spread.

    Might be worth asking other casinos if they'll enable manual DOGE withdrawals. The option exists in their systems, just hidden from the standard cashier interface.

    This is why I avoid altcoin deposits entirely. Ignition Casino and Slots.lv keep it simple - Bitcoin deposits, Bitcoin withdrawals, no conversion games.

    The DOGE network might be faster and cheaper, but these casinos are clearly using the deposit/withdrawal mismatch to generate extra revenue through exchange spreads. They're betting most players won't calculate the real cost.

    For smaller deposits under $100, the BTC network fee might cost more than the DOGE conversion spread. But for anything over $300, you're better off eating the Bitcoin mining fee and avoiding their exchange rates.
